This quiet residential area in Kent County offers spacious living with generous lot sizes averaging about a third of an acre, giving families room to spread out and enjoy private outdoor space. The community feels secluded and peaceful, with over 90% of homes being owner-occupied, creating a stable neighborhood atmosphere. While you'll need a car for most daily activities, nearby amenities include several grocery stores within a short drive and Maplewood Park for outdoor recreation.
Families are drawn to the area for the highly-rated Jenison Public Schools, which average strong performance across all grade levels. The larger lots and quiet streets make this an appealing choice for those seeking privacy and space while staying connected to the greater Grand Rapids area. This location works best for families who value room to grow, strong schools, and a peaceful suburban lifestyle away from busy commercial areas.
